Williams Selyem found its success buying and bottling single-vineyard wines, with Pinot Noir as the focus. Single-vineyard wines were not new to California, but the first for Williams Selyem was its 1985 Rochioli Vineyard Pinot Noir.
While Pinot Noir dominates production, Williams Selyem also makes a small amount of Chardonnay, Zinfandel, and a Port-style fortified dessert wine. These offerings vary in production from year to year but many also carry single-vineyard designations.

| Robert Parker Rating | The most seductive but somewhat superficial wine is the 2004 Pinot Noir Westside Road Neighbors, made from the fruit of five nearby vineyards that are blended together. This has a slightly darker color than the previous two wines, with more sweet cherry, damp earth, and underbrush notes. |
|---|
| Antonio Galloni Rating | (60% new oak) Good red-ruby. Exotic, very ripe aromas of cherry, raspberry, cola and orange peel. Broad, lush and fat, with expressive flavors of strawberry, minerals and spices along with some loamy earth tones. Finishes with lush tannins and lingering sweetness. A classic Russian River Valley pinot made mostly from fruit from the Allen, Riverblock, Flax, Bucher and Bacigalupi vineyards. |
|---|
| Wine Spectator Rating | Sleek and delicate, with a trim band of spicy cherry, earth, mineral and sage. Ends with a dash of citrus that gives it a cleansing quality. |
